For example, it’s okay to be an average employee! Stop working harder and start working smarter. Hard work only gets you more hard work — and maybe a tiny pay increase. Studies have shown that you can make more money job hopping than staying at the same company year after year.
“Companies don’t want to hire job hoppers!”
They’ll find any reason to disqualify you. I’ve once done 5 interviews wearing my naturally curly hair and got denied from every single one. The moment I wore my hair straightened, I made it to the final round with 3 different companies. The wrong company will always find a reason to make you the wrong candidate.
You have to do what’s best for you! That doesn’t mean giving up on Corporate America and walking out of your job. It means to change your mindset regarding your job. Choose to stop allowing them to use you as their pawn in their chess game. Stop relying on others to facilitate your movement up the corporate ladder and keep you paid.
